## Ticket: Signature check failure during FD-leak hunt

While instrumenting the Corvasse daemon to trace leaked file descriptors, the patched build failed its signature check at startup and refused to load. The instrumentation step strips the original signature, so test builds must be re-signed before deployment to the staging ring. Re-signing requires the staging key, noted below for the sync.

signing key of bagap-yawep = bky13_TbfT6ZMUoGJo2

Subject: Reviewing version bumps in Loomkit

Hi — welcome to the rotation. When reviewing PRs against Loomkit, our shared component library, check that every change touching a public prop includes a semver bump in the manifest. Patch for styling, minor for new props, major for removals. Reviewers before you have let silent breaking changes through, which is why downstream teams at Harrowfield pin exact versions now. The full versioning policy and exception process are written up here:

operations page: https://confluence.tolvaqsys.corp/spaces/pages/pages/6e787158f507

Step 6: Deploying the history service for CanvasLoom. The undo/redo stack is persisted server-side, so drain in-flight mutations before swapping binaries — otherwise users lose redo branches created mid-deploy. Run the drain script, wait for the mutation queue to report zero, then roll the new build region by region. Verify undo depth on a test diagram afterward. Each release artifact must be signed before the orchestrator will accept it; use the following key.

deploy key for kajof-yawif: bky9_fvxrpdHPq